Gaelic Storm

Gaelic Storm will provide a distinctive style of music Fri., Nov. 4. The Celtic genre band is most known for their appearance on the 1997 film, “Titanic,” where they played “Irish Party in Third Class,” which can be found on their 1998 “Herding Cats” album. Gaelic Storm will go on at 8 p.m. and tickets can be purchased for $20.
